
Cleaning up raw chicken juice is essential to prevent cross-contamination and the spread of harmful bacteria like Salmonella and Campylobacter. Start by immediately blotting the spill with paper towels to absorb as much liquid as possible, avoiding spreading it further. Next, sprinkle a generous amount of baking soda or salt over the area to neutralize odors and absorb remaining moisture. Let it sit for 10 minutes, then sweep or vacuum the residue. Follow this by cleaning the surface with a disinfectant solution, such as a mixture of one tablespoon of bleach per gallon of water or a food-safe antibacterial cleaner. Finally, wash your hands thoroughly with soap and water after handling raw chicken or cleaning the spill to ensure personal hygiene and safety.

Use paper towels to absorb juice
Raw chicken juice is a biohazard, teeming with pathogens like Salmonella and Campylobacter. Immediate cleanup is critical to prevent cross-contamination. Paper towels are your first line of defense. Their highly absorbent cellulose fibers act like microscopic sponges, trapping liquid within their matrix. Unlike cloth towels, which can spread bacteria, paper towels are disposable, eliminating the risk of recontamination.
For maximum effectiveness, use a "blotting" technique. Press the paper towel firmly onto the spill, allowing it to soak up the juice without smearing it. Avoid rubbing, as this can spread bacteria further. Replace the towel frequently to prevent saturation, which reduces absorbency and increases the risk of drips.
While paper towels excel at initial absorption, they shouldn't be your only weapon. After removing the bulk of the liquid, disinfect the area with a solution of 1 tablespoon of unscented bleach per gallon of water. Let it sit for 10 minutes before wiping it dry with a fresh paper towel. This two-pronged approach ensures both physical removal of the juice and chemical destruction of lingering pathogens.
Remember, paper towels are a temporary solution. Dispose of them immediately in a sealed trash bag to prevent bacteria from spreading through the air or attracting pests. This simple, inexpensive method is a crucial step in maintaining a safe and hygienic kitchen environment when handling raw chicken.

Wash area with hot, soapy water
Raw chicken juice is a breeding ground for harmful bacteria like Salmonella and Campylobacter, which can survive on surfaces for hours. When spilled, these pathogens pose a cross-contamination risk to other foods and utensils. The first line of defense against this invisible threat is a thorough cleaning with hot, soapy water. This method physically removes debris and bacteria, while the heat and detergent work together to break down fats and kill microorganisms.
Begin by removing any visible debris from the affected area using a disposable paper towel. Avoid using sponges or cloth towels, as these can harbor bacteria and spread them further. Once the area is free of solid particles, apply hot water—ideally at a temperature of 110°F (43°C) or higher—to loosen grease and grime. Follow this with a generous amount of dish soap, which contains surfactants that lift away oils and organic matter. Scrub the area vigorously for at least 20 seconds, ensuring all surfaces are covered, including cracks and crevices where bacteria can hide.
While hot, soapy water is effective for most surfaces, it’s crucial to consider the material you’re cleaning. Porous surfaces like wood or unsealed stone may require additional steps, such as disinfection with a food-safe sanitizer after washing. Non-porous surfaces like stainless steel or plastic are easier to clean but still demand thorough scrubbing to ensure all contaminants are removed. Always rinse the area with clean, hot water afterward to eliminate soap residue, which can attract dirt and bacteria if left behind.
A common mistake is underestimating the importance of drying the cleaned area. Bacteria thrive in moist environments, so use a clean paper towel or air-dry the surface completely. For added safety, especially in kitchens, follow up with a disinfectant approved for food contact surfaces. This two-step approach—cleaning with hot, soapy water followed by disinfection—ensures a hygienic environment free from harmful pathogens.
In summary, washing the area with hot, soapy water is a critical step in neutralizing the risks associated with raw chicken juice. It’s a simple yet powerful method that combines temperature, mechanical action, and chemistry to eliminate bacteria. By following these specific steps and considering the surface material, you can effectively safeguard your kitchen against cross-contamination and foodborne illnesses.

Disinfect surfaces with bleach solution
Raw chicken juice can harbor harmful bacteria like Salmonella and Campylobacter, making proper disinfection of contaminated surfaces critical. Bleach, a powerful antimicrobial agent, is a go-to solution for this task. Its active ingredient, sodium hypochlorite, effectively kills pathogens when used correctly. However, its strength demands precise handling to ensure safety and efficacy.
To disinfect surfaces with bleach, start by preparing a diluted solution. Mix 1 tablespoon (15 ml) of unscented, 5-6% sodium hypochlorite bleach per gallon (3.8 liters) of water. This concentration is sufficient for most household surfaces without being overly harsh. For smaller areas, scale down the ratio proportionally, such as 1 teaspoon (5 ml) of bleach per quart (946 ml) of water. Always wear gloves to protect your skin, as bleach can cause irritation.
Apply the bleach solution to the contaminated surface using a clean cloth, sponge, or spray bottle. Ensure the area remains wet for at least 10 minutes to allow the bleach to fully neutralize bacteria. This dwell time is crucial for effectiveness. Avoid wiping or rinsing the surface prematurely, as doing so reduces the solution’s disinfecting power. For porous surfaces like cutting boards, consider using a food-safe alternative, as bleach can leave harmful residues.
While bleach is highly effective, it’s not without risks. Never mix bleach with ammonia, vinegar, or other cleaning agents, as this can produce toxic fumes. Proper ventilation is essential when using bleach to prevent inhalation of its strong vapors. After disinfection, rinse food-contact surfaces with clean water to remove any residual bleach. Store bleach solutions in a labeled, airtight container, out of reach of children and pets, and discard any unused mixture after 24 hours, as it loses potency over time.
In comparison to other disinfectants like alcohol or hydrogen peroxide, bleach offers a cost-effective and readily available option for high-risk areas. However, its corrosive nature requires careful application, especially on metal or painted surfaces. For routine cleaning, bleach may be overkill, but for raw chicken juice spills, its reliability in eliminating pathogens makes it a top choice. By following these steps and precautions, you can safely harness bleach’s power to protect your kitchen from cross-contamination.

Clean utensils and cutting boards separately
Cross-contamination is a silent kitchen hazard, especially when handling raw chicken. Utensils and cutting boards that come into contact with raw poultry can harbor harmful bacteria like Salmonella and Campylobacter. To prevent these pathogens from spreading to other foods, it’s crucial to clean utensils and cutting boards separately. This practice ensures that bacteria aren’t transferred from one surface to another during the cleaning process.
Begin by designating separate sinks or basins for washing utensils and cutting boards if possible. If using the same sink, clean utensils first, followed by cutting boards, to minimize the risk of contaminating smaller items. For utensils, use hot, soapy water and scrub thoroughly, paying attention to crevices where bacteria can hide. Dishwashers are effective for utensils, provided they’re washed on a sanitizing cycle with water reaching at least 160°F (71°C). Cutting boards, however, require more attention due to their porous surfaces.
For cutting boards, start by scraping off visible debris with a bench scraper or spatula. Wash the board with hot, soapy water, then sanitize it using a solution of 1 tablespoon of unscented bleach per gallon of water. Let the board sit in the solution for several minutes before rinsing thoroughly. Alternatively, white vinegar (undiluted) can be used as a natural disinfectant, though it’s less potent than bleach. Avoid submerging wooden cutting boards, as this can cause warping; instead, wipe them down with a cloth soaked in the sanitizing solution.
A comparative analysis reveals that plastic cutting boards are easier to sanitize than wooden ones due to their non-porous nature, but wooden boards have natural antimicrobial properties. Regardless of material, always air-dry cutting boards completely before storing to prevent bacterial growth. Utensils should be dried immediately with a clean towel or allowed to air-dry on a rack.
In conclusion, separating the cleaning process for utensils and cutting boards is a simple yet effective way to prevent cross-contamination. By following these steps—designating cleaning areas, using appropriate sanitizers, and ensuring thorough drying—you can maintain a safe kitchen environment. This practice not only protects your health but also reinforces good hygiene habits that extend to all food preparation tasks.

Dry area thoroughly to prevent bacteria
Raw chicken juice is a breeding ground for harmful bacteria like Salmonella and Campylobacter, which can survive on surfaces for hours. Even after wiping away visible liquid, moisture can linger, creating a hospitable environment for bacterial growth. This residual dampness, often overlooked, is a critical factor in cross-contamination, potentially leading to foodborne illnesses.
To effectively eliminate this risk, drying the area thoroughly is non-negotiable. Simply wiping with a damp cloth isn’t enough; the goal is to remove all traces of moisture. Use a clean, dry paper towel or cloth to absorb any remaining liquid, applying gentle pressure to ensure no pockets of dampness persist. For larger spills or porous surfaces like wood cutting boards, air-drying is recommended—leave the area exposed to circulation for at least 10–15 minutes.
A comparative analysis of drying methods reveals that heat can expedite the process. A hairdryer on low setting or a clean towel warmed in the dryer can be particularly effective for stubborn moisture. However, caution is necessary: excessive heat may damage certain surfaces, and the tool itself must be sanitized afterward to avoid recontamination.
The takeaway is clear: drying isn’t just a final step—it’s a critical measure in breaking the chain of bacterial survival. By ensuring surfaces are completely dry, you deny pathogens the moisture they need to thrive, significantly reducing the risk of illness. This simple yet vital practice transforms a routine cleanup into a safeguard for health.
